随着5G的规模部署,对传输网络提出更大带宽、更低时延的要求。作为面向5G的综合业务承载平台,切片分组网(SPN)统一承载无线业务、家庭宽带业务和政企专线业务等,业务量的激增迫使SPN汇聚层和核心层急需大带宽长距传输技术。对SPN彩光技术及组网方案进行研究,包括业务需求、技术方案、组网方案、产业及标准进展等,并进行实验室和现网测试,验证SPN彩光组网功能和性能。
